引言
在如今的信息化社会,服务器的搭建和维护对于各类企业及个人用户来说愈显重要。帕鲁服务器作为一种高效的服务器架构,不仅可以提供优质的性能,还能在数据安全和管理上给用户带来极大的便利。本文将从帕鲁服务器的定义、搭建步骤、策略、常见问题以及进阶技巧等多个方面进行详细介绍,助您快速掌握帕鲁服务器的搭建与维护。
什么是帕鲁服务器?
帕鲁服务器是一种基于特定高效算法设计的服务器架构,它通常用于处理大数据、实时数据分析以及高并发请求的场景。与传统的服务器架构相比,帕鲁服务器在性能、可扩展性以及安全性上都有显著优势。其架构设计灵活,可以根据需求进行横向和纵向扩展,并且支持多种操作系统和开发环境。
搭建帕鲁服务器的基础条件
在开始搭建帕鲁服务器之前,首先需要了解一些基础条件,包括硬件配置、网络环境和软件要求。一般来说,帕鲁服务器需要较强的CPU、充足的内存以及大容量的存储空间。网络带宽方面,至少应有稳定的高速互联网接入。此外,必须选择合适的操作系统(如Linux)、持久化存储(如SQL、NoSQL数据库)以及各种必要的软件组件(如Web服务器、缓存中间件等)。
搭建帕鲁服务器的步骤
以下是搭建帕鲁服务器的详细步骤:
- 选择合适的硬件:确保您的服务器硬件符合帕鲁服务器的要求,处理器通常推荐使用多核CPU,内存至少要有16GB以上。
- 选择操作系统:推荐使用Linux操作系统,如Ubuntu或CentOS,因为其在服务器环境中的稳定性和安全性非常高。
- 安装必要的软件:安装Web服务器(如Nginx或Apache)、数据库(如MySQL或MongoDB)、编程语言环境(如Python、Java等)以及其他需要的组件。
- 配置网络:确保服务器的网络连接稳定,并配置好必要的域名解析和防火墙规则,以保护服务器的安全。
- 部署应用:将您的应用程序部署到帕鲁服务器上,并按照需求配置数据库和其他服务。
- 测试与:在正式上线前进行全面测试,包括性能测试和安全测试,发现问题及时。
- 监控与维护:上线后,需对服务器的运行状态进行实时监控,并根据使用情况进行相应的维护操作。
帕鲁服务器的性能
为了充分发挥帕鲁服务器的性能,进行相应的显得尤为重要。以下是一些行之有效的策略:
- 缓存机制:通过使用Redis或者Memcached等缓存中间件,减轻数据库的压力,提高应用响应速度。
- 负载均衡:使用负载均衡器将请求分发到多个服务器上,避免某一台服务器负载过重,提升整体性能。
- 数据库:根据查询需求合理设计数据库结构,建立索引,减少冗余数据,提高查询效率。
- 内容分发网络(CDN):利用CDN加速静态资源的加载,提升用户访问体验。
- 代码:遵循编程规范,减少代码冗余,选择高效的算法和数据结构。
常见问题及解决方案
帕鲁服务器的安全性如何保障?
安全性是服务器搭建中不可忽视的一部分,尤其是在数据泄露和黑客攻击频发的今天。为了保障帕鲁服务器的安全性,可以采取以下措施:
- 防火墙:启用服务器防火墙,配置相应的规则来限制未授权访问。
- 定期更新:及时更新操作系统和应用程序的安全补丁,以修补潜在的漏洞。
- 数据加密:对于敏感数据,使用加密算法进行加密保护,确保数据在传输和存储过程中的安全。
- 定期备份:定期对服务器的数据进行备份,以便在数据丢失的情况下进行恢复。
- 访问控制:采用强密码政策和多因素身份验证,限制对服务器的访问权限。
此外,建议定期进行安全检查,及时发现和修复安全隐患。在需要的情况下,可以借助专业的安全服务商来进行渗透测试,以全面评估服务器的安全性。
如果我的帕鲁服务器遭遇DDoS攻击,该如何应对?
DDoS(分布式拒绝服务)攻击是一种常见的网络攻击手段,目标是通过向服务器发送海量请求以使其瘫痪。为了有效应对DDoS攻击,可以采取以下措施:
- 流量清洗:使用流量清洗服务,通过提前检测和过滤不正常请求,确保正常流量不受影响。
- CDN加速:使用CDN可以分散请求,减轻源服务器压力,有效防止DDoS攻击。
- 动态防火墙:部署动态防火墙,根据实时流量数据调整防护策略,屏蔽可疑IP地址。
- 限制请求速率:对每个IP地址设置请求速率限制,有效降低攻击效应。
- 建立应急计划:制定应对DDoS攻击的应急预案,确保在攻击发生时能迅速响应。
总之,抵御DDoS攻击需要全面的安全意识和技术手段,企业在日常运维时应随时关注网络安全动态,并保持警惕。
如何监控和维护帕鲁服务器的运行状态?
有效监控和维护服务器运行状态是保障帕鲁服务器高效运转的重要环节,以下是一些监控和维护策略:
- 使用监控工具:借助如Zabbix、Nagios等开源监控工具,实时监控服务器的CPU、内存、存储、网络等使用情况。
- 设置告警机制:根据监控数据设置告警规则,以便在出现异常时能第一时间反馈给运维人员。
- 定期查看日志:定期分析服务器日志,发现潜在问题并进行。
- 性能测试:定期进行性能测试,包括压力测试和负载测试,确保服务器在不同负载下稳定运行。
- 运行环境:根据监控数据进行相应的调整,如调整资源分配、升级硬件等。
通过建立一套完整的监控和维护机制,不仅能提升服务器的安全性,还能确保系统在高负载情况下的稳定运行。
帕鲁服务器和传统服务器的区别在哪里?
帕鲁服务器与传统服务器在设计和使用上有着根本的差别,主要体现在以下几个方面:
- 架构灵活性:帕鲁服务器通常具有更高的架构灵活性,可以根据负载情况进行动态扩展,而传统服务器则在扩展方面比较有限。
- 性能:帕鲁服务器在数据处理性能、并发处理能力上比传统服务器更优越,适合大规模应用场景。
- 安全性:帕鲁服务器在安全架构设计上更加注重,通常会集成多种安全防护机制,而传统服务器在安全性上缺乏系统化设计。
- 运维管理:帕鲁服务器往往通过集中管理平台进行运维,远程管理变得更加方便,而传统服务器则需要较多人工干预。
- 使用场景:帕鲁服务器适合于需要实时数据处理和高性能计算的应用场景,而传统服务器多用于文档处理简单应用。
总之,帕鲁服务器在性能、安全和管理上比传统服务器更为先进,适应现代企业对于高效能和高可靠性的需求。
有哪些应用场景适合使用帕鲁服务器?
帕鲁服务器因其优良的性能和安全性,适合于多种应用场景,例如:
- 大数据分析:帕鲁服务器能够处理海量数据,适合于实时数据分析、数据挖掘等需求。
- 在线游戏:高并发请求的在线游戏需要稳定的后端支持,帕鲁服务器能满足其对性能的需求。
- 电子商务:帕鲁服务器能够提供快速的响应,适合于电商平台在流量高峰期处理请求。
- 内容管理系统(CMS):大型CMS平台需要高效的服务器支持帕鲁服务器可提供所需的性能。
- 云计算平台:作为云计算的基础架构,帕鲁服务器能够支持不同规模的云计算服务。
在选择应用场景时,可以根据具体业务需求以及预算进行综合考虑,确保搭建出的帕鲁服务器能够高效满足业务运行需求。
结语
帕鲁服务器的搭建和是一个复杂但又极具挑战性的过程。通过掌握基础知识和各种技术手段,任何人都可以构建出高效、安全的服务器环境。在实际运用中,建议结合具体业务需求,灵活调整架构和配置。同时,密切关注网络安全和性能,以确保服务器能够长久稳定地为用户提供服务。希望本篇文章能够对您建立帕鲁服务器有所帮助,让您在这一技术领域迎风而上,走向更高的成就。